Planning Permission in Nottingham: 93.6% Approval Rate

Nottingham Council approves 93.6% of planning applications, based on 6,278 real decisions analysed from the council’s public planning portal. The national average across all councils tracked by PlanningLens is 88.0%. Nottingham sits 5.6 percentage points above the national average.

Planning Approval Rates by Ward in Nottingham

Ward-level data reveals where planning applications are most and least likely to succeed. Officers, local policies, and neighbourhood character all play a role.

Ward variation in Nottingham: Bestwood has the highest approval rate at 98.2%, while Radford sits at 88.4%. That 9.8 percentage point gap matters — where your property sits can shift your odds significantly.

About Nottingham Planning Data: This analysis draws on 6,278 planning decisions published by Nottingham council. Every application is classified as approved or refused based on the council's own decision wording. Withdrawn applications and procedural outcomes are excluded.
